Halal transportation adoption among food manufacturers in Malaysia: the moderated model of technology, organization and environment (TOE) framework

Abstract: Purpose This study aims to identify the factors influencing the intention to adopt Halal transportation among Halal food manufacturers in Malaysia. Design/methodology/approach Applying a purposive sampling method, data were gathered from questionnaires distributed to Halal food manufacturers who participated in Halal showcase and festival in Malaysia. Out of 317 companies who were approached, 290 respondents agreed to answer the questionnaire and only 247 can be used for data analysis. SMART-partial least sq… Show more
